Airport-exchange rule

Airport currency kiosks quote rates 5–15% worse than any bank ATM inside the terminal. If you need cash on landing, use an in-terminal bank ATM — not the "0% commission" kiosks (the margin is in the rate).

Frequently asked

Q.What currency is used at Taipei Songshan (TSA)?

Taiwan uses the TWD (NT$). Airport ATMs dispense TWD directly — skip the exchange kiosks.

Q.How much should a taxi from TSA to the city cost?

Expected fare on the TSA → Taipei 101 route is roughly TWD 25 MRT / TWD 200 taxi. Around TWD 400+ is already high, and TWD 600+ off-meter is a scam quote — confirm the meter or a printed rate before you get in.

Q.Do I tip taxi drivers at TSA?

Not expected. Drivers in Taiwan don't rely on tips the way US drivers do; inflated "tips" are sometimes used to justify an overcharge — pay the metered fare first, then decide.

Q.Cash or card for a taxi at TSA?

Cash preferred for taxis; EasyCard works at some. "Card machine broken" is the most common excuse to force a cash overpay — carry a small stack of TWD notes and you keep the leverage.

Q.Should I change money at TSA?

Only if you need $10–20 of TWD to cover a taxi or a SIM card. Airport exchange kiosks quote 5–15% worse than a bank ATM in the same terminal. If your card has no FX fee, just pay by card and skip cash entirely.
